QUESTION

I have an 8 pg. modified fin. agreement, parent plan, final judgement. Are there attorneys who will assist reviewing for small flat fee, not retainer?

Need assistance with reviewing a financial agreement (2 pages), a parenting plan (3 pages), and a final judgement modification (3 pages) for a flat rate before I sign it. I do not need further representation afterwards. My ex-husband is an attorney himself and he prepared the documents, so it would be beneficial to me to have an attorney look at these to see if there is any legal wording that is incorrect or misrepresenting on my behalf.

I am sure there are attorneys who would review your documents for a flat fee or a fee without a retainer. Just call a few and inquire as to their fee structure and the cost for the review. Good luck!
